Note 1 The nominal current settings doesn’t concern the protection elements; they must agree with hardware setting (dip-switch 1 A or 5 A) .
Note 2 The basic current I
B
represents the nominal current of the line or transformer, referred to the nominal current of the CT’s for thermal image
protection. If the secondary rated current of the line CT’s equals the rated current of the NA20 relay, as usually happens, the I
B
value is the ratio
between the rated current of the protected element and the primary rated current of the CT’s
Note 3 The 26 element is available when the MPT module is connect on Thybus and enabled
